Описание

Free learning in endodontics, for which you will receive 4,75 CE points!


During the online course you will learn:


– Protocols of the use of MTA in conservative and surgical endodontics

– Dentin-pulp complex responses to carious lesions: microscopic analysis

– Decision making in nonsurgical root canal retreatment.

Урок 1.Free example. The use of MTA in conservative and surgical endodontics

– Evolution and properties of MTA

– Indications for the use of MTA in conservative and surgical endodontics

– Apical barrier technique

– Perforation closure by vertical compaction method

– MTA removal: indications and tactics

– Protocols for the use of MTA in endodontics:

 

- how to seal an open apex

- perforation under the microscope

- how to protect a pulp exposure to perform a direct pulp capping

- retrograde filling.

 

– Long-term results of using MTA in endodontics.

 

Recommended for: Endodontists, Pediatric dentists, General dentists.

Урок 3.Dentin-Pulp Complex Responses To Carious Lesions: Microscopic Analysis

– Anatomy of Dens evaginatus

– Pulpal and periapical diagnosis

– Histological analysis of superficial and moderate carious lesions

– Histological analysis of deep caries lesion

– Pulp exposure due to caries

– Crack lines diagnosis with the help of CBCT

– Histological analysis of asymptomatic irreversible pulpitis

– Biofilm formation within dentinal tubules: histological analysis

– Biofilm formation within the root canals: histological analysis

– Obturation of lateral root canals: mistakes and how to avoid them

– Obturation of root canals in three dimensions: Guidelines.


Recommended for: Endodontists, General dentists.

Урок 4.Decision making in nonsurgical root canal retreatment

– Multidisciplinary approach in endodontic treatment

– Nonsurgical root canal retreatment VS surgical approach: decision making algorithm

– Diagnosis and treatment planning: the role of CBCT

– Root canal retreatment: indications and contraindications

– Criteria for the success of root canal retreatment

– Treatment of an asymptomatic tooth: endodontical aspects.


Recommended for: Endodontists, General dentists.
